Two students decided to investigate the effect of water and air on iron object under identical experimental conditions. They measured the mass of each object before placing it partially immersed in 10 ml of water. After a few days, the object were removed, dried and their masses were measured. The table shows their results.
| Student | Object | Mass of Object before Rusting in g |
Mass of the coated object in g |
| A | Nail | 3.0 | 3.15 |
| B | Thin plate | 6.0 | 6.33 |
What might be the reason for the varied observations of the two students?
Advertisements
उत्तर
Rusting occurs in both A and B so there is an increase in mass. As the surface area of B is more, extent of rusting is more.
